La nature et l'idée d'impermanence
La nature est au cœur de l'art japonais, souvent comme une manière de penser le temps. Le terme "mono no aware" décrit la conscience du caractère éphémère des choses, et la beauté qui s'y loge. La fleur de cerisier incarne exactement cette beauté brève et saisonnière, quand la montagne se lit comme quelque chose de plus constant. C'est un sujet discret, qui récompense des années de cohabitation avec un tirage plutôt que quelques semaines.
De l'Ukiyo-e à aujourd'hui
La filiation est longue. L'estampe Ukiyo-e a prospéré du XVIIe au XIXe siècle, avec Katsushika Hokusai et Utagawa Hiroshige pour définir ses paysages. L'art occidental a ensuite beaucoup emprunté à ces estampes ; Van Gogh et Monet les collectionnaient et les copiaient. Le minimalisme qui définit encore le design japonais, le "moins c'est plus", est ce qui rend ces affiches si faciles à intégrer dans un intérieur moderne.
